Slab 4 in Amrita Vishwavidyalaya means you need to pay regular fees of Rs 2,80,000 .
In slabs 1,2,3 you get a scholarship fees .
In slab 4 the fees would range higher than other slabs .
Along with hostel ,the fees would range around 3.5lakhs
